Enhancing Air Purity: Understanding ACH in Cleanrooms
Maintaining optimal air purity within cleanrooms is paramount to ensure the integrity of sensitive processes and products. A crucial factor in achieving this goal is the understanding and implementation of Air Changes per Hour (ACH).
